The Nuclear Company is seeking a Software Quality Engineer to ensure the reliability, safety, and compliance of its software products within the nuclear energy industry, adhering to strict regulations and best practices.

Requirements

  • Proficiency in software test automation using languages like Python, Java, C, or similar.
  • Experience with test management tools (e.g., Jira, Azure DevOps, TestRail) and version control systems (e.g., Git).
  • Familiarity with industry standards related to software quality and configuration management.
  • Software Quality Assurance (SQA) Methodologies
  • Test Automation Development
  • Test Planning & Execution
  • Defect Management

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ement robust test cases for complex, safety-critical software applications.
  • Design, develop, and execute various types of software tests, including functional, integration, system, regression, performance, and security testing.
  • Utilize and implement test automation frameworks and tools to increase efficiency and coverage.
  • Perform thorough defect tracking, reporting, and verification, working with developers to ensure timely resolution.
  • Maintain comprehensive software quality documentation, including test reports, traceability matrices, and validation reports.
  • Help drive continuous improvement in software quality processes, methodologies, and tools.
  • Contribute to a culture of quality, test automation, and robust software engineering practices throughout the development lifecycle.

Other

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, Software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or a related technical field.
  • 5+ years of progressive experience in software quality assurance or software testing roles for complex, enterprise-level applications.
  • Minimum of 2+ years of direct experience in the nuclear energy industry or another highly regulated, safety-critical industry (e.g., aerospace, defense, medical devices, automotive safety systems).
  • Strong understanding of the full software development lifecycle (SDLC) and various testing methodologies (Agile, Waterfall).
